• Question: Does the Naval Shipworm lay eggs or not

    Asked by kingolive85 to Naval Shipworm on 2 Dec 2017.
    • Photo: Naval Shipworm

      Naval Shipworm answered on 2 Dec 2017:


      Hi! The naval shipworm has lots and lots of eggs, but it keeps them inside itself – it raises its young inside its gills until they are old enough to be released into the ocean, when they swim off to find a new place to settle!
